{"id":5361,"date":"2017-04-21T08:39:47","date_gmt":"2017-04-21T07:39:47","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/sesc.cat\/stone-like-lung-lesions-in-a-horse-carcass\/"},"modified":"2022-03-24T18:52:14","modified_gmt":"2022-03-24T17:52:14","slug":"stone-like-lung-lesions-in-a-horse-carcass","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/sesc.cat\/en\/stone-like-lung-lesions-in-a-horse-carcass\/","title":{"rendered":"Stone-like lung lesions in a horse carcass"},"content":{"rendered":"<p>In a 21 years old, cross breed, mare carcass several masses \u00a0with a very hardened consistency (stone-like) and considerable size (10-15 cm) were observed located in the right apical lobe and in the ventral margins of diaphragmatic lobes.<!--more--><\/p>\n<p>Histopathological study showed multifocal lesions of <strong>granulomatous, chronic, inflammatory nature<\/strong>. These lesions developed areas of extensive fibrosis\u00a0with\u00a0mineralization or <strong>osseous metaplasia<\/strong> (i.e. bone tissue that is generated in the center of the \u00a0fibrous lesion, which explains the hardness of the lesions found on the carcass).<\/p>\n<p>A series of tests were performed to determine the cause of these inflammatory lesions: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>The Ziehl Neelsen staining was unable to determine the presence of mycobacteria. Both PCR and direct mycobacteria culture also gave negative results.<\/li>\n<li>The Gram stain did not allow to observe gram positive bacteria.<\/li>\n<li>Neuther did Groccott&#8217;s stain allow to observe fungal structures.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Thus it was not possible to determine the etiology of these lesions probably because of their advanced chronicity preventing to identify the cause. A neoplastic process was ruled out.<\/p>\n<p>In the differential diagnosis an <strong><a href=\"http:\/\/journals.sagepub.com\/doi\/abs\/10.1354\/vp.44-6-849?url_ver=Z39.88-2003&amp;rfr_id=ori:rid:crossref.org&amp;rfr_dat=cr_pub%3dpubmed\">equine multinodular pulmonary fibrosis<\/a><\/strong>\u00a0 was included, it is a disease associated with <strong>equine herpesvirus 5<\/strong> infection. Again, the chronicity of the lesion makes it difficult to associate it to this entity.<\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_3355\" style=\"width: 460px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><img loading=\"lazy\"
